Content distribution network in short CDN is known as the system of computers that contains copies of certain data which are placed at different points within a network to maximize bandwidth with help of which you can access data from your clients throughout the network. The nodes of CDN are developed in many locations and often over many backbones. All these nodes work with each other to satisfy the end users request for content. Optimization helps you to reduce bandwidth costs, improving the performance and increase in availability of the content. The architechture decides how many nodes you can attach there?
If you want to optimize the costs for the content distribution network (CDN) you should choose the location which is least expensive. If you take an optimal scenario, suppose there are two goals which are tending to align as because the severs which are close to end user who are at the edge of the network can be able to get some advantages in the performance or cost. Design of internet will be done on the basis of end-end principle. Due to this principle the core network becomes specialized and simplified but only to forward you data packets.
The end to end transport system of the network in content distribution network (CDN) augments different applications. The techniques that are designed for optimizing content delivery can lead to server-load balancing, content services and request routing. The work of web caches is to accumulate popular content on servers which have greatest demand for content requested. The work of these shared networks is to reduce down the bandwidth requirements and to reduce server load. These balancing of server-load use techniques which include service abased or hardware based which can also be called as content switch, web switch or multilayer switch which will help you to share traffic between a series of servers.
In Content distribution Network(CDN) these switch have a single virtual IP address as a result of which the traffic which are arriving to the switch is directed to any one of the web servers that are attached to it. The advantage of this is balancing load, improving the scalability and increasing the total capacity. A service node is generally formed of 4-7 layer of switch which helps to balance across a series of web caches located within the network. The request routing directs a request of client to the closest client node or to the one which have the most capacity.
Content distribution networks (CDN) uses series of different content delivery which are not limited for any manual assets and for the hardware load balancer (global). The request for content has been typically diverted to nodes which are optimal. While optimizing for the content performance, locations which are best for serving the content to you will be chosen. To optimize the delivery properly across the local networks you must choose locations with the fewest hops. If you are trying to establish such network you should have knowledge about the CDN.
Author Resource:
David Henzel is the author of this article on Content Delivery Network .
Find more information about CDN here.